Indara Chief Executive Cameron Evans confirms he has resigned from the role of CEO, effective 31 December 2024. Media speculation suggesting his role was terminated is incorrect.
Mr Evans said: “With the completion of the establishment phase of Indara, I have taken the time to reflect on the leadership of the organisation going forward.
“I have determined that now is the right time for me to resign and allow the company to pursue growth under new leadership.
“I will be remaining with Indara focused on the business and a successful transition until my departure on 31 December this year.
“From a customer perspective, nothing changes, the business remains committed to maintaining the strong strategic partnerships we have formed.”
Indara Chair, Sue O’Connor, said: “The Board greatly appreciates the work that Cameron has done to bring Indara to the strong position it is in today.
“I would like to thank Cameron for his leadership, commitment, and dedication over the past three years.
“He leaves with our thanks and best wishes for his future. We look forward to the future with confidence as Indara continues to strive to be the premier independent digital infrastructure provider.”
